Senior Tendering Engineer

Location: Manchester or Hebburn - This is a hybrid role which will allow you to split your time between home and either the Manchester or Hebburn office. The role will require travel occasionally between the two offices.

Shape the Future of Power Systems with Siemens

At Siemens Electrification & Automation, we're shaping the future of energy systems by connecting the real and digital worlds. As a Senior Tendering Engineer, you'll play a pivotal role in delivering innovative, customer-focused systems that power critical infrastructure across the UK and Ireland

Join Siemens Electrification & Automation as we revolutionize energy systems by bridging the real and digital worlds. As our Senior Tendering Engineer, you'll craft innovative power solutions that energise critical infrastructure across the UK and Ireland.

You'll make a difference by:
  • Generate high-quality technical and commercial proposals for medium-voltage switchgear (AIS/GIS), protection systems, and digital solutions using Siemens' design tool NXTools.
  • Review RFQs and enquiry documents to understand customer requirements from both technical and commercial perspectives.
  • Prepare budgetary and firm bids, including offer documentation, cost calculations, delivery timelines, supporting proposal materials.
  • Interpret customer specifications and tender documents to develop compliant and competitive offers.
  • Coordinate with procurement to ensure accurate specifications and competitive pricing.
  • Provide technical clarifications to internal stakeholders (Sales, Operations, Engineering).
  • Participate in technical discussions with clients and partners to support proposal alignment.
  • Engage with customers and partners to clarify requirements and present proposals professionally.
  • Maintain project tracking tools and contribute to achieving order intake targets.
  • Analyze bid outcomes (win/loss) to identify trends and improvement opportunities.
  • Contribute cost optimization ideas to Product Lifecycle Management (PLM) and Operations.
  • Collaborate cross-functionally with engineering, sales, procurement, and project management to ensure accurate costings, risk assessments, proposal optimization, and effective delivery strategies.
  • Support internal bid reviews and approvals, ensuring compliance with Siemens' technical and commercial governance.

You'd describe yourself as
  • HNC or equivalent in Electrical Engineering
  • Strong MV systems knowledge
  • Understanding of protection schemes
  • Digital substation technology experience
  • Commercial acumen
  • Proven experience in energy/utilities sector
  • Understanding of switchgear market
  • Knowledge of utility, ICP, and EPC requirements
  • Siemens switchgear experience (advantageous)
